three large towns or cities called Dallas in the US Dallas Texas to California= Texas, New Mexico, Arizona, California. Dallas Georgia To California = Georgia, Alabama, Mississippi, Louisiana, Texas, New Mexico, Arizona, California Dallas Oregon, = Oregon, California
